Which is the cheapest way to send a parcel?
Drop Off and drop your shipping costs Another smart way to save money and send your parcel the cheapest way is to book online and Drop Off. When the courier does not have the expense of coming to collect from your home or work address, this cost can be removed from the process.
Out of the three major carriers, USPS is typically the cheapest option. After that, UPS comes in at a close second, and FedEx ranks as the most expensive (yet arguably most reliable) carrier. Since it offers the best mix of affordability and service, USPS is the most popular small ecommerce shipping solution.09-Jun-2021

Can you send cash via UPS?
Unfortunately, you cannot send cash via courier companies such as DHL, UPS, FedEx, TNT or DPD. This includes any legal tender such as bank notes and coins.13-Nov-2017

Can you refuse a parcel?
Can you refuse a parcel delivered to you? Yes. You can refuse a parcel which was not addressed to you but it ended up at your location. You can also refuse the shipment that you were expecting if it didn't arrive in a good condition and has clear signs of damages.

How much does it cost to post a small parcel UK?
A standard letter that weighs up to 100g costs 76p using stamps or 69p with a franking machine and 65p with Mailmark. A small package that weighs 1-2kg costs up to £6.00 when posting in the United Kingdom.

How do I know if my letter has been delivered?
You can request a Proof of Delivery for applicable mailpieces by using the USPS Tracking® Tool at USPS.com®. Select Proof of Delivery and follow the provided directions to receive a Proof of Delivery email either with or without a delivery address.
You can check the status of your item by entering a code online at USPS's Track and Confirm page or by calling a number on the form. Stamps.com customers can use retail USPS Tracking by combining PS Form 152 with either NetStamps labels or when printing postage directly onto envelopes.
Does Australia Post charge by size or weight?
For parcels that are over 1kg, where you use your own packaging or any other packaging which is not eligible for the national flat rates for postage based on size, Australia Post will assess charges according to their actual weight or cubic weight equivalent, whichever is greater.
